Step back in time and enjoy a feeling of another era but, don't you won't be sacrificing modern conveniences.An unexpected strip of ravines and canyons, the Arikaree Breaks region in the northwestern tip of Kansas stands out in sharp contrast to the surrounding plain. The rugged canyonland, just two to three miles wide, cuts diagonally across northern Cheyenne County and stretches just across the state line west into Colorado and north into Nebraska. The Kansas High Plains region is an area of vast flatlands and gently rolling plains. Topographic relief is largely restricted to streams and river valleys and is most notable in the Arikaree Breaks in the far northeast corner of the state, at Point of Rocks along the Cimarron River in the far southwest corner, and around Lake Scott State Park.

The Arikaree River, a tributary of the North Fork of the Republican River, is a 156-mile-long long waterway in the central Great Plains.. It flows east out of Yuma County, Colorado, through the extreme northwestern corner of Kansas through Cheyenne County for about 10 miles, before making its way through the southwestern portion of Nebraska to its mouth near the town of Haigler, where it joins ...They form a two-to-three-mile-wide break of rough terrain between the plains of northwestern Kansas and eastern Colorado and the south sides of the Arikaree and Republican river basins. The breaks extend from Rawlins County, Kansas westward across Cheyenne County, Kansas and into Yuma County, Colorado. Distance: 8.1 mi. online education administration degree This is Horse Thief Cave in the Arikaree Breaks, Kansas. In the 1800s horse thievs (apparently) stashed stolen horses in the cave. Whether that's factual or just local legend, I have no idea. But some explanation is needed about the whole "cave" thing.
